Causes Physical Factors Brain Abnorbilities Low birth weight Respiratory Infection
Causes cont’d Sleep environmental factors Sleeping on the stomach or side Sleeping on soft surfaces Sleeping with parents
Risk Factors Age Family History Second hand smoke Parent younger than 20 Smokes Drugs or alcohol Prenatal care
Dealing with SIDS Communicate your feelings Allow time for healing Counseling Support Group
Prevention Feet to Foot Crib as bare as possible Overheating of infant Sleeping alone Pacifier NO SMOKING DURING PREGNANCY No smoking around the baby
